Default IQ3 and haltech display not showin gear/gas

Hi, have had the iq3 hooked up 2 ma haltech ems and it does not display which gear i am in usin the gear sensor and there aint no way of seein how much fuel is in the tank. Has anyone sorted these issues out? thanks in adv.

Haltech does not read fuel level readings and there for it will not output it onto the IQ3. I'd contact whomever you purchased your dash from in order to get the correct sensor from Racepak.

As far as the gear sensor we've not even bothered to look into that feature.

I don't think it's ******** at all - I have it in my car.

It is not car specific, so there are some things that display automatically (whatever info Haltech passes through) and some that require additional setup - none of it is any big deal to do however if you understand what you're doing and you have a factory service manual. It is like any other computer - it relies on the inputs in order to give you the outputs.

I have no use or need for gear indicator as I don't have a sequential gearbox, but their setup instructions in the instructions are very detailed for getting it to work.

You can moniter fuel level as well if you want...or any other sensor for that matter. It's just a matter of having the dash talk to whatever sensor you want it to moninter. For fuel level, you will need to purchase an additional module from Racepak and then program the dash to recognize the resistance ratings of the factory fuel level sensor, which are found in the factory service manual.

I would suggest contacting Racepak directly for any more in depth help you need, or, find a local motorsport oriented shop that can handle the programming for you
